What Darktrace ActiveAI Security Platform does
Darktrace ActiveAI combines behavioral baselines, cross-domain correlation, automated investigation, exposure management, and autonomous response across security environments.
Darktrace ActiveAI is a modular enterprise security platform built around behavioral understanding. Instead of relying only on known indicators, its Self-Learning AI models what is normal for users, devices, applications, cloud resources, and industrial systems, then detects significant deviations. Cyber AI Analyst investigates alerts and assembles incident narratives, while cross-domain correlation connects activity across network, email, cloud, identity, endpoint, OT, and third-party sources. Proactive exposure, attack-surface, readiness, recovery, and managed services extend the platform before and after detection.
Darktrace does not publish a standard rate card. Price depends on modules, monitored users, devices, traffic, cloud accounts, endpoints or industrial assets, data and retention, sensors and deployment, integrations, managed detection and response, support, implementation, and contract. Buyers should request a line-item quote and test the exact architecture because a network proof of value does not validate email, cloud, OT, or endpoint coverage. Baseline learning time, encrypted traffic visibility, remote sites, data paths, and operational support also affect total cost and effectiveness.
Behavioral anomaly detection necessarily produces uncertainty: legitimate business changes can look hostile, and quiet malicious activity can resemble normal use. Autonomous Response can reduce dwell time but may also disrupt production, identity, email, network, or OT operations when scope is wrong. Begin in observe-only mode, label maintenance and seasonal patterns, integrate asset criticality and change management, and tune actions per domain. Require human approval for broad blocks or safety-critical systems, preserve forensic evidence, test fail-open and rollback behavior, and measure false positives, missed detections, and business interruption.
How Darktrace ActiveAI Security Platform works
Darktrace sensors, connectors, and integrations observe permitted activity across selected network, email, cloud, identity, endpoint, OT, or other domains. Self-Learning AI establishes evolving behavioral baselines and finds anomalies; cross-domain correlation and Cyber AI Analyst investigate evidence. Autonomous Response can apply targeted controls according to configured scope while analysts review incidents and business impact.
Establish behavioral baselines
Sensors and connectors observe authorized network, email, cloud, identity, endpoint, OT, and other activity. Models learn evolving normal behavior for entities within the visibility and retention available.
Identify meaningful deviations
Self-Learning AI scores anomalies and correlates them across domains. Business changes and rare legitimate actions can resemble threats, so asset importance and maintenance context matter.
Assemble incident evidence
Cyber AI Analyst automatically investigates surrounding activity and creates an incident narrative. Human analysts compare it with raw telemetry, threat intelligence, change records, and gaps.
Stage targeted autonomous response
Approved response controls can interrupt suspicious behavior in real time. Begin narrowly, exclude fragile or safety-critical assets, test rollback, and measure false positives and disruption.
How to set up Darktrace ActiveAI Security Platform
Map the protected digital estate
Inventory networks, users, email, identity, cloud, endpoints, OT, remote sites, traffic paths, critical assets, privacy constraints, and existing controls.
Scope modules and commercial terms
Request pricing by domain, assets, data, sensors, retention, integrations, services, implementation, support, region, and renewal; document proof-of-value boundaries.
Deploy visibility safely
Use least-privilege connectors, validate sensor coverage and encrypted traffic limits, protect management access, define data retention, and test network and system performance.
Learn and tune in observe mode
Allow baselines to form across normal business cycles, label maintenance and rare legitimate events, replay known incidents, and measure false-positive and missed-detection behavior.
Stage autonomous response
Start with narrow reversible controls, exclude safety-critical and fragile systems, require approval for broad action, test rollback, and continuously audit response impact.
Darktrace ActiveAI Security Platform FAQs
How much does Darktrace ActiveAI cost?
Darktrace provides custom quotes based on selected modules, users or assets, data, deployment, integrations, services, support, and contract.
What is Self-Learning AI?
Darktrace describes models that learn normal behavior from an organization's own environment and identify meaningful deviations rather than relying only on known attack signatures.
What does Cyber AI Analyst do?
It automatically investigates alerts, correlates surrounding evidence, and produces an incident narrative or conclusion for security analysts to review.
Can Darktrace block threats automatically?
Autonomous Response can apply targeted controls when configured. Organizations should stage actions, protect critical systems, require approval where impact is high, and test rollback.
Will behavioral AI eliminate false positives?
No. Business changes, rare administration, new systems, seasonal work, and incomplete visibility can appear anomalous. Continuous tuning and human investigation remain necessary.
